General Files, 1917-1991
- Abstract Or Scope
-
The General Files consist principally of correspondence between Syz and his colleagues in psychiatry and medicine. Other correspondents include professional organizations, literati, students and associates of the Lifwynn Foundation, and friends of the Syz family. The files are arranged alphabetically, and a guide to the correspondence prepared by Syz in folder one provides some topical indexing. The series contains little correspondence of a personal nature. Most folders include both incoming and outgoing correspondence. Other material in the files include memoranda of meetings, clippings, reprints, manuscripts and newsletters. The bulk of correspondence falls between 1926 and 1981.
